What Is the Purpose of Architecture Plans?

Architecture plans are technical documents that describe the full design of a construction project before work gets underway. They typically contain floor plans, elevation drawings, structural layouts, plumbing diagrams, and material specifications. These documents function as the primary communication tool between the client, the architect, the contractor, and the municipal office.

Mechanically, the creation of architecture plans requires multiple professional fields working in coordination. A credentialed architect translates your requirements into technical drawings that incorporate structural loads, zoning laws, setback requirements, and material capabilities. The result is a collection of technical files that tells every trade exactly what to do and in what manner.

Architecture Plans FAQ

How long does it usually to develop a full set of architecture plans?

Timeline varies based on design requirements. Smaller residential projects like garage conversions often run four to eight weeks from kickoff to permit submittal. More complex projects such as commercial buildings may need three to six months to complete in detail. Our professionals will provide an accurate schedule projection at your first consultation.

What does it cost for architecture plans in Walnut Creek?

Cost depends heavily by design complexity. Straightforward additions may fall in the range of a few thousand dollars, while complex multi-unit buildings can involve significantly higher professional costs. What materials do I need to bring to start the architecture plans process?

To start your architecture plans, it helps to have a copy of your property survey, any previous blueprints on the building, a detailed breakdown of the proposed project, and your desired timeline. Our team can work with whatever materials you are able to share and identify what remains to gather.

Will the architecture plans need to carry a license seal by a licensed architect?

In most cases, yes. California permit offices demand that documents for permitted projects bear the seal and authorization of a California-licensed architect or professional engineer. Can architecture plans be revised after submission?

Yes, but modifications once filed require a plan change application with the building department, which extends the timeline.
